Trials

The trials are open to girls 16 years and over, and are being held in four locations around Australia. They will run for four hours, including registration. 

The ARU coaches will give you an introduction to Sevens Rugby and an overview of the High Performance Program. This will be followed by general measurements, in addition to fitness and skills testing, including coordination, spatial awareness and catching. There will be no contact involved.

There is no commitment from you at this stage in terms of time and training, and you’ll be able to continue to play your current sport. If you are successful at these trials, there is a three-day (over a weekend) Development Camp at the Australian Institute of Sport in Canberra at the end of the year.
